Not only did some poor slob get arrested, he also angered someone with nuyen to burn and a taste for a dish of ice cold revenge. The bad news is the slob's death must look accidental and prison-like. Course, that makes sense since he's currently in prison. The good news is that the prison is out in the boondocks, so we're not talking about a full-frontal on a maximum security installation.
Can you trust your memories? In your case, no. Everything you thought you knew about yourself was a lie, a carefully constructed cover story. Really you're a highly-trained government agent who specializes in missions so bizarre they would drive the average person mad. But now that you've been reactivated, do you still have what it takes? Can you retain your fragile sense of identity without losing your sanity?
A man you knew by reputation only invited you to a party. As you talk to the other guests you find the only thing you have in common with them is none of them knew your host. As the party progressed and you tried to find some link with others, and you discovered you all have unusual skills. When you finally met your host, he offered you a position as a freelancer for his agency. Your first job is to find the murderer of an 500 year old vampire.

The time: Today. The place: Washington DC. The event: The end of the world. Play a seemingly ordinary DC resident (dentist, street punk, Senator's daughter, or Secret Service agent) facing the collapse of civilization. Try to stay alive. Rise to the occasion. You'll discover that you're anything but ordinary.
During a visit to Greece the heroes become embroiled in the search for the lost tomb of the first apostle, Andrew. Others seek the same goal, however, and donât intend to let the heroes stand in their way.
